Hi,

During a rebuild of all packages in sid, your package failed to build on
amd64.

Relevant part:
> make[1]: Entering directory 
> `/build/user-gpe-calendar_0.92-2-amd64-3PNAYL/gpe-calendar-0.92'
> for i in ./config.guess ./config.sub  ; do \
>               if test -e $i.cdbs-orig ; then \
>                       mv $i.cdbs-orig $i ; \
>               fi ; \
>       done
> make[1]: Leaving directory 
> `/build/user-gpe-calendar_0.92-2-amd64-3PNAYL/gpe-calendar-0.92'
> if [ "debian/stamp-patched" = "reverse-patches" ]; then rm -f 
> debian/stamp-patched; fi
> patches: debian/patches/010-configure.ac.patch 
> debian/patches/020-desktop-standard.patch debian/patches/030-configure.patch 
> debian/patches/040_migrate_to_soup_2.4.patch
> Trying patch debian/patches/010-configure.ac.patch at level 1 ... success.
> Trying patch debian/patches/020-desktop-standard.patch at level 1 ... success.
> Trying patch debian/patches/030-configure.patch at level 1 ... 0 ... 2 ... 
> failure.
> make: *** [debian/stamp-patched] Error 1

The full build log is available from:
   
http://people.debian.org/~lucas/logs/2009/08/22/gpe-calendar_0.92-2_lsid64.buildlog

A list of current common problems and possible solutions is available at 
http://wiki.debian.org/qa.debian.org/FTBFS . You're welcome to contribute!

About the archive rebuild: The rebuild was done on about 50 AMD64 nodes
of the Grid'5000 platform, using a clean chroot.  Internet was not
accessible from the build systems.
